On the south east coast of texas, the Gulf Coast Prairies and Marshes ecoregion are located. The topography consists of plain flat land and the elevation is low. The soil type is mainly sandy and the vegetation near the coast is sparse. Thus, strong winds such as hurricanes and storm will carry away the looses sandy soil and lead to beach erosion thereby destroying habitats for animals such as turtles, pelicans etc.

The 'Rolling Plains' ecoregion of Texas is the most susceptible to wind erosion due to its grassland ecology and the nature of its sandy and loamy soils.
In the state of Texas, the ecoregion most likely to be affected by wind erosion would be the G. rolling plains. This area is predominantly comprised of grasslands, which lack the root structures and vegetation density of other regions like forests to hold the soil firmly in place. Therefore, they are more susceptible to the wind's forces. The sandy and loamy soils found in this ecoregion also contribute to vulnerability as they are lighter and more easily picked up by wind. Unlike these grasslands, regions like East Texas Piney Woods and Gulf Coast prairies and marshes have more vegetation coverage, minimizing the possibility of wind erosion.
